Understanding Free Fitness AI APIs
The evolution of fitness technology is being driven by the mainstream availability of advanced AI APIs. These digital building blocks serve as the connection point between raw health data and actionable insights, powering more than just gyms. They now influence fields from sports science to patient recovery.

Unlike traditional systems limited to counting steps or calories, AI-powered APIs decipher complex relationships within user behavior, biometric data, and preferences to deliver truly personalized experiences. For example, TensorFlow Lite’s open-source models enable real-time evaluation of exercise form, applicable in physiotherapy and professional athletics. Meanwhile, OpenCV’s computer vision tools provide immediate posture analysis valuable not only for fitness but also for ergonomic assessments in the workplace.
Democratization is the engine of this revolution. Previously, only well-funded platforms could leverage such AI firepower. Today, fitness studios, clinics, educators, and independent innovators can access the same sophisticated tools, giving rise to health tech solutions tailored to local cultures, special populations, and neglected needs.
Core Features of Digital Coaching APIs
Biometric Analysis
Modern fitness AI APIs excel at processing diverse biometric data streams, unlocking applications far beyond basic fitness:
- Heart rate variability (HRV) analysis for optimizing workout intensity, stress reduction, and even post-surgical recovery
- Movement pattern recognition for form correction, injury prevention, and rehabilitation progress tracking
- Sleep quality metrics for adjusting training loads and supporting cognitive performance in high-stress professions
- Respiratory rate monitoring during exercise and clinical environments
The open-source Mediapipe framework, for example, lets developers implement advanced motion tracking with up to 95% accuracy. This enables not just gym-goers but also physical therapists and occupational health experts to detect and correct movement patterns without expensive, specialized hardware.
Personalization Engines
AI-driven personalization transcends basic workout suggestions. Today’s APIs integrate a web of user data, creating experiences tailored across various contexts:
- Analysis of historical performance data for progress benchmarking in sports training or chronic disease management
- Dynamic difficulty adjustment based on real-time feedback, adapting to both elite athletes and seniors in wellness programs
- Recovery optimization leveraging sleep, stress, and hormonal data, aiding everyone from shift workers to university students
- Dietary and nutritional needs integration, offering personalized meal planning in wellness apps and campus health platforms
These engines continuously refine their recommendations. For instance, an implementation using the H2O.ai framework led to a 40% boost in adherence to fitness and rehabilitation programs compared to static routines. This result is mirrored in other realms such as diabetes management and post-injury recovery.
Progress Tracking and Analytics
Fitness APIs shine in translating raw data into actionable, motivating feedback:
- Automated milestone recognition and achievements drive engagement in digital wellness challenges and school sports
- Predictive analytics spotlight performance plateaus and guide timely interventions in both fitness and workplace safety programs
- Visual progress mapping via computer vision brings intuitive feedback not just to gym users but also to physical therapy patients
- Social comparison features, designed with robust privacy controls, foster healthy motivation in both fitness communities and employee health platforms
Developers can now build rich, continuous engagement loops that empower users while offering granular insights to trainers, clinicians, and program administrators.
Implementation Considerations
Technical Integration
Launching fitness AI APIs within real-world solutions demands attention to several technical pillars:
- Data privacy and compliance (including HIPAA, GDPR, and other regional standards)
- Real-time processing for immediate, actionable feedback in high-stakes environments such as elite training or remote patient monitoring
- Seamless cross-platform compatibility, ensuring apps work across smartphones, tablets, wearables, and enterprise dashboards
- Robust scalability planning for communities or organizations with rapidly expanding user bases
For example, developers using the OpenAI GPT API for adaptive workout planning must employ rate limiting and caching strategies to ensure smooth, responsive experiences even at scale. Similar strategies apply in other domains, such as mental health support lines or campus wellness systems.
User Experience Design
The ultimate impact of AI-powered fitness coaching hinges on user experience. Achieving meaningful engagement requires:
- Clear, digestible presentation of complex health metrics for users of varying literacy levels
- Intuitive feedback and coaching dialogs that foster trust and keep users motivated
- Smart intervention timing, offering suggestions when most valuable—from daily routine nudges to tailored recovery plans
- Thoughtful, stepwise introduction of advanced features to prevent overwhelm and nurture sustained participation
Careful UX design bridges the technical sophistication of AI with human usability. Creating interfaces that empower all users, from gym newcomers to high-performance athletes and busy professionals, remains critical.
Comparing AI and Human Coaching
AI-powered coaching brings unparalleled consistency and accessibility, but the most effective digital health paradigms emerge from blending human expertise with intelligent systems. This hybrid approach delivers holistic value across domains.
AI Strengths:
- 24/7 availability and instant feedback, crucial for shift workers, athletes, and busy parents
- Consistent data collection and analysis, supporting large-scale workplace or population health initiatives
- Scalable personalization, serving hundreds or thousands without loss of nuance
- Objective, data-driven progress measurement, reducing human error and bias
Human Coach Strengths:
- Emotional intelligence, empathy, and the nuanced motivation that drives behavior change
- Ability to detect subtle cues and context, critical in injury prevention and complex goal setting
- Context-sensitive judgment, integrating lifestyle factors, mental resilience, and social dynamics
- Deep domain expertise and adaptability in unforeseen scenarios or crises
Platforms integrating both human and AI coaching have reported up to 60% higher client retention and improved outcomes in sectors ranging from corporate wellness and youth sports development to outpatient rehabilitation.

Future Developments and Trends
The fitness AI ecosystem continues its rapid ascent, with several groundbreaking developments on the horizon:
- Integration of genetic and microbiome data for even more precise, individualized exercise and nutrition guidance
- Advanced natural language processing enabling conversational and emotionally attuned digital coaching for mental health and chronic care support
- Augmented and virtual reality coaching environments, providing immersive training and rehabilitation experiences in both at-home and clinical settings
- Edge computing for ultra-fast, local data processing; especially vital for remote monitoring, emergency response, and competitive athletic contexts
These innovations are not confined to traditional fitness. They are also driving down costs, increasing access, and transforming how we deliver preventive healthcare, community fitness, employee wellness, and personalized education. Some organizations report as much as an 80% reduction in service delivery costs compared to traditional models.
The continued convergence of open, accessible AI APIs with new health technologies is propelling both innovation and equity. Solutions once unimaginable or prohibitively expensive are becoming reality in communities, institutions, and industries worldwide.
